About This Item

London: The Crime Club / Collins 1981 Hardcover. 000231349X First UK edition. This copy has been signed by the author on the title page. The first Harry Stoner detective novel. 224 pages. Owner's name and date to front free endpaper, spine slanted, very light wear, in dust jacket with a 1/2" tear and associated creasing at the rear corner of the spine head. LR2/4E
